21xrx.com
2024-09-19 09:28:02 Thursday
登录
文章检索 我的文章 写文章
个数的阶乘
2023-06-14 15:15:24 深夜i     --     --
C语言 程序编写 阶乘

如何使用C语言编写程序求n个数的阶乘?

对于初学者来说,要使用C语言编写程序求解n个数的阶乘可能会有些困难。但是,只要你掌握了一些基本的编程概念和技术,就可以轻松完成这个任务。

计算n个数的阶乘需要将n个数从1到n相乘。我们可以使用for循环来实现这个功能。具体实现代码如下:


#include

int main()

{

  int i, n, result = 1;

  printf("请输入一个数字:");

  scanf("%d", &n);

  for(i = 1; i <= n; i++)

  {

    result = result * i;

  }

  printf("%d的阶乘是%d", n, result);

  return 0;

}

上面的代码首先要求用户输入一个数字n,然后使用for循环从1到n依次相乘,将结果保存到变量result中。最后,程序会输出n的阶乘。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复